How Will Mold Impact My Residence and Family?

The spores of mold are everywhere in the air, only becoming noticeable when conditions are right, and the fungus finds an ideal surface to colonize. The fungus typically thrives in shadowy and damp spaces. Among other assistance, your knowledgeable mold inspector will detect the source of the moisture – whether it's from recent flooding or leaks – to help you develop a plan for remediation. Mold can be almost any color, including red, green, yellow, white, and black, which is famously associated with a particularly dangerous species, Stachybotrys chartarum, known to trigger dangerous health effects in some individuals and pets.

Although mold is not harmful for the majority of people, it does cause serious cosmetic issues and a damp odor. Even more concerning, the fungus consumes the surfaces that it colonizes, compromising materials and weakening the structural integrity of a building over time. It eats cellulose materials that are frequent in just about every house, including:

  • Drywall
  • Wood
  • Carpet
  • Insulation
  • Ceiling tiles
  • Wallpaper
  • Fabrics
  • Upholstery
  • Some Painted surfaces
  • Paper
  • Cardboard
  • And More

Mold testing can discern the species and expose the source of moisture contributing to an infestation inside of your current home or the one you're thinking about buying. A common question posed to mold inspectors is if it's possible to test a person for mold poisoning. Unfortunately, this cannot be tested by our mold inspection service but can be performed by your doctor with blood and skin screening. Some aspects in how your mold inspector conducts testing may vary from house to house, but will generally involve the following:

  • Initial Assessment: The mold inspector gathers information about the property, any established mold issues, and your apprehensions during the initial consultation to design a plan for mold testing.
  • Visual Inspection: The next step of our mold inspection service includes a comprehensive visual examination of the property, both inside and out, seeking for signs of mold growth, water leaks, and other moisture-related problems. We check areas vulnerable to mold infestation, like basements, crawl spaces, bathrooms, attics, and spaces with plumbing or heating and cooling systems.
  • Moisture detection: Assessing moisture content in areas around the home is essential in discovering potential sources of mold spread. Moisture sensors and other tools are used to evaluate the moisture levels of building materials and detect areas with high humidity or water intrusion behind walls, under flooring, or in other concealed areas. Infrared tools may be used to locate areas where mold colonization may be occurring.
  • Air Sampling: Mold testing may necessitate air samples to be collected from multiple areas of the home using customized equipment. The air samples will be dispatched to a lab for analysis to establish the type and concentration of mold spores found in the air.
  • Surface Sampling: The inspector may also make surface samples from portions of the home where mold is suspected. These samples will be dispatched to a lab for analysis to establish the type of mold found.
  • Documentation and Reporting: Findings are documented, including observations, measurements, sample locations, and analysis findings. A detailed report is prepared, recapping the inspection information, mold types identified, and suggested steps for cleanup, if necessary.
  • Recommendations and Remediation Plan: If mold is found, the inspector may give recommendations for mold cleanup, which may involve hiring a expert mold remediation company. They will likely suggest measures to alleviate moisture intrusions, improve airflow, and avoid future mold growth.
  • Follow-up and Clearance Testing: A post-remediation assessment may be conducted to verify that the cleanup efforts were successful and that the mold issue has been properly addressed.
  • Education and Prevention: The inspector enlightens the client about mold precaution measures, including appropriate airflow, humidity management, and care procedures.

What Do I Need To Do To Get Ready for My Mold Inspection?

You can follow a few straightforward steps to aid your mold inspector in carrying out a thorough and complete home inspection. Activities not to do include cooking, smoking, using chemical cleaners, or using air purifiers to avoid interfering with air measurements that your mold inspector may obtain.

You should guarantee clear access to spaces that your mold inspector will need to access by clearing obstacles and hindrances that may impede the examination. Additionally, supply appropriate details about any prior water incidents or plumbing issues in the home. It's also beneficial to record locations of worry with photographs or notes to aid in possible remediation measures.
